首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法删除MariaDB表中的字段

在MariaDB中,无法直接删除表中的字段。这是因为MariaDB不支持直接删除表中的字段,而是通过创建一个新的表,将原表中的数据复制到新表中,并在新表中排除要删除的字段来实现删除字段的效果。

以下是一个完整的步骤来删除MariaDB表中的字段:

  1. 创建一个新表,命名为"new_table",并包含需要保留的字段。可以使用CREATE TABLE语句来创建新表,例如:
  2. 创建一个新表,命名为"new_table",并包含需要保留的字段。可以使用CREATE TABLE语句来创建新表,例如:
  3. 在上面的例子中,我们保留了"id"、"column1"和"column3"这三个字段。
  4. 将原表中的数据复制到新表中。可以使用INSERT INTO语句将数据从原表复制到新表,例如:
  5. 将原表中的数据复制到新表中。可以使用INSERT INTO语句将数据从原表复制到新表,例如:
  6. 在上面的例子中,我们将"original_table"中的"id"、"column1"和"column3"字段的数据复制到"new_table"中。
  7. 删除原表,并将新表重命名为原表的名称。可以使用DROP TABLE语句删除原表,然后使用RENAME TABLE语句将新表重命名为原表的名称,例如:
  8. 删除原表,并将新表重命名为原表的名称。可以使用DROP TABLE语句删除原表,然后使用RENAME TABLE语句将新表重命名为原表的名称,例如:
  9. 在上面的例子中,我们删除了"original_table",然后将"new_table"重命名为"original_table"。

通过以上步骤,我们成功地删除了MariaDB表中的字段。请注意,在执行这些操作之前,务必备份原表的数据,以防止意外数据丢失。

对于MariaDB的相关产品和产品介绍,腾讯云提供了MariaDB数据库服务,可以满足各种规模和需求的业务。您可以访问腾讯云的MariaDB数据库服务页面(https://cloud.tencent.com/product/cdb-mariadb)了解更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券